Tree canopy thinning services involve selectively reducing the density of branches and foliage in a tree’s upper layers. This process is typically performed by trained professionals who carefully prune and remove specific limbs to improve the overall health and structure of the tree. The goal is to allow more light to reach the ground and other plants beneath the tree, enhance air circulation within the canopy, and reduce the risk of branch failure during storms. Proper thinning can also help maintain the tree’s aesthetic appearance and prevent it from becoming overly congested or structurally unstable over time.
One of the primary issues addressed by canopy thinning is the prevention of storm damage. Overly dense canopies can create wind resistance, increasing the likelihood of branches breaking or the entire tree toppling during high winds or heavy snow. Additionally, thick foliage can promote the buildup of moisture and decay, which may lead to fungal infections or pest infestations. Thinning helps mitigate these problems by reducing excess weight and improving airflow, thereby promoting healthier growth and decreasing the potential for hazardous conditions around the property.

The overview below groups typical Tree Canopy Thinning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Englewood,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Thinning - Costs typically range from $200 to $600 for small to medium trees. The price depends on tree size and the extent of thinning required.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ific tree conditions.
Selective Crown Thinning - Expect to pay between $300 and $900 per tree. This service involves removing specific branches to improve health and appearance, with costs varying by tree complexity.
Deep Crown Reduction - Prices generally fall between $500 and $1,200 for larger trees. This process involves significant pruning to reduce height and spread, often requiring specialized equipment.
Emergency Thinning Services - Emergency or urgent thinning can cost from $400 to $1,500 depending on the tree’s size and location. Local service providers can assist with immediate needs to prevent hazards.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
